Spinach and Goat's Cheese Fillo Pastry Roll

Cultural Context

Originating from Mediterranean cuisine, spinach and goat's cheese fillo pastry rolls are a delightful blend of flavors and textures. Traditionally served as appetizers or snacks, they showcase the region's love for fresh ingredients and flaky pastries. In modern cuisine, variations abound, with fillings ranging from vegetables to meats, making them a versatile choice for gatherings and parties.

Servings4
1 package fillo pastry
8 oz fresh spinach
8 oz goat cheese
4 oz dates, chopped
1 teaspoon black pepper
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 pear, diced

1

Soften dates by placing them in boiling water for about 5 minutes.

2

Take the fillo pastry out of the fridge about an hour before using.

3

Brush olive oil between layers of fillo pastry to keep it from crumbling.

4

Chop wilted spinach to avoid large pieces in the dish.

5

Mix chopped spinach with goat cheese and black pepper in a bowl.

6

Chop softened dates and add to the spinach and goat cheese mixture.

7

Roll the fillo pastry around the filling, brushing with olive oil to seal.

8

Bake the filled pastry roll for about 20 minutes at 200 degrees Celsius.

9

Prepare a salad with sliced and diced pears, adding lemon juice to prevent oxidation.

10

Serve the baked fillo roll with the pear salad on the side.
